Philippine esports firm banks $10.6m in series A money

Mineski Global, an esports and gaming organization based in the Philippines, has raised US$10.6 million in a series A round led by Exacta Capital Partners and joined by Endeavor Catalyst.

Mineski has been creating gaming content since 2004, while participating and hosting esports tournaments across the globe. The firm, which began as a college DotA team, has since grown to a 200-member-strong company that provides a software-as-a-service esports marketing offering to generate more opportunities for brands.

The company said that it plans to use the new capital to broaden its gamification technology portfolio, introduce new products, bring in new talent, and expand further across Southeast Asia.

In addition to the Philippines, it also has a presence in Thailand and Indonesia. It has also worked with gaming giants such as gaming and lifestyle major Razer, Riot Games, which is the developer of games like League of Legends and Valorant, as well as mobile gaming titan Tencent.

“With the tremendous growth of esports and gaming, we believe this is the right time to invest in that future,” said Mineski Global chairman and CEO Ronald Robinson Robins.

Without disclosing any further information, Mineski said it has seen “strong growth” over the last few years and expects to double its sales this year.

Meanwhile, industry heavyweight Razer’s recent earnings report also helped highlight the recent surge in gaming, reporting a profit of US$31 million in the first half of 2021.
